AudioOutputDescriptor: improve refcount logging

Improve refcount to match exact client descriptor
Abort on invalid client descriptor refcounts
Log changes to active clients and refcounts

Test: dumpsys of media.audio_policy

@@ -103,16 +103,37 @@ bool AudioOutputDescriptor::sharesHwModuleWith(
    }
}

void AudioOutputDescriptor::changeStreamActiveCount(audio_stream_type_t stream,
void AudioOutputDescriptor::changeStreamActiveCount(const sp<TrackClientDescriptor>& client,
                                                    int delta)
{
    if (delta == 0) return;
    const audio_stream_type_t stream = client->stream();
    if ((delta + (int)mActiveCount[stream]) < 0) {
        ALOGW("%s invalid delta %d for stream %d, active count %d",
              __FUNCTION__, delta, stream, mActiveCount[stream]);
        mActiveCount[stream] = 0;
        return;
        // any mismatched active count will abort.
        LOG_ALWAYS_FATAL("%s(%s) invalid delta %d, active stream count %d",
              __func__, client->toShortString().c_str(), delta, mActiveCount[stream]);
        // mActiveCount[stream] = 0;
        // return;
    }
    mActiveCount[stream] += delta;

    if (delta > 0) {
        mActiveClients[client] += delta;
    } else {
        auto it = mActiveClients.find(client);
        if (it == mActiveClients.end()) { // client not found!
            LOG_ALWAYS_FATAL("%s(%s) invalid delta %d, inactive client",
                    __func__, client->toShortString().c_str(), delta);
        } else if (it->second < -delta) { // invalid delta!
            LOG_ALWAYS_FATAL("%s(%s) invalid delta %d, active client count %zu",
                    __func__, client->toShortString().c_str(), delta, it->second);
        }
        it->second += delta;
        if (it->second == 0) {
            (void)mActiveClients.erase(it);
        }
    }

    ALOGV("%s stream %d, count %d", __FUNCTION__, stream, mActiveCount[stream]);
}
